1. Pick one image to examine closely.
2. Study the image as a whole. What do you notice first?
3. Look at the foreground and background. Study the setting.
4. Think: Is this image trying to convey a mood or message?
5. Choose one way to respond in your notebook:
- I see…. This makes me think…. I wonder….
- I think the artist created this painting to show…
- I think the photographer took this photo to show…
- This image tells me that….
6. If you have extra time: Compare and Contrast 2 images at your center.
